Brazen Framework - Framework

Main class of the Brazen framework

These are versions of this script where the code was updated. Show all versions.

  • v7.2.1 2026-06-09

    Changed

    • downloadDuplicateLedgerSkip Duplicate Downloads (OPTION_ENABLE_DOWNLOAD_DUPLICATE_LEDGER, default on) gates all ledger checks. When off, downloads proceed normally; stored ids are kept so users can re-download after deleting files locally.
    • Default tooltip: OPTION_ENABLE_DOWNLOAD_DUPLICATE_LEDGER_HELP.

    Added

    • Constructor ledger options: enableConfigKey, enableHelpText, enableDefault.
    • _isDownloadDuplicateLedgerActive() — protected helper for apps with enqueue-time duplicate logic.
  • v7.1.1 2026-06-09
  • v7.1.0 2026-06-09
    • branding change
    • various new functionalities
  • v7.0.4 2026-05-27

    Added platform agnostic safe folder name truncation for downloads

  • v7.0.3 2026-04-19

    Fix another case of illegal character combination for downloads

  • v7.0.2 2026-03-14
    • fixed download file name cleanser
  • v7.0.1 2025-12-30

    Added ruleset sorting

  • v7.0.0 2025-12-30
    • sync configuration manager
    • code style update
  • v6.13.0 2025-12-07

    Added support for multiple instances of tag blacklist filters

  • v6.12.5 2025-09-06

    Added option to customize rows for blacklist filter

  • v6.12.4 2025-08-15

    Made some config items optional for a more focused approach

  • v6.12.3 2025-08-15

    Made after compliance run callback more reliable and is now called when all kinds of compliance runs are completed.

  • v6.12.2 2025-08-09

    Fixed a typo causing syntax error

  • v6.12.1 2025-07-26

    Fixed folder not being created for downloads

  • v6.12.0 2025-07-26
    • Added illegal character removal from download file names
    • Added option to remove media element when download is initiated.
  • v6.11.0 2025-07-16

    Added config toggle to perform item compliance

  • v6.10.0 2025-07-05

    Sync UI generator

  • v6.9.1 2025-06-15

    Fixed UI resize not being possible when pane is not set to always show.

  • v6.9.0 2025-06-15

    Added capability to add comments to tag rules.

  • v6.8.0 2025-05-04

    Add option to disable UI generation

  • v6.7.1 2025-04-29

    Fixed settings backup file download

  • v6.7.0 2025-04-29
    • Added compliant item class so such items can be selected
    • Added item hide and show handlers in configuration object so they can be cleanly overridden
  • v6.6.1 2025-04-28

    Fixed text blacklist

  • v6.6.0 2024-11-06
    • Added support to choose item finding method in between find and children
    • Fixed white space inclusion in tags when combination rules are used in blacklist
  • v6.5.0 2024-10-19

    Removed UI before and after event assignment methods

  • v6.4.0 2024-09-20

    Refactored tags support with customizable item attribute based tag blacklist as well as capability to have multiple tag based rule set filters

  • v6.3.1 2024-05-27

    Animation change for settings menu hide

  • v6.3.0 2023-12-22
  • v6.2.0 2023-10-30

    Separate switches for preset blacklists

  • v6.1.0 2023-10-14

    Some optimized use case based shortcut methods to perform more complex operations

  • v6.0.4 2023-09-25

    Removed left over console log

  • v6.0.3 2023-09-04

    Fixes

  • v6.0.2 2023-09-04

    Minor verbiage change

  • v6.0.1 2023-09-04

    Fixes

  • v6.0.0 2023-09-03
    • Tag blacklist and highlighting features
    • Converted event handlers to queues
  • v5.4.2 2023-08-09
    • Fix pagination config entries not being retrieved from local cache
  • v4.0.1 2023-08-09
    • Fixed pagination config values not getting defined if paginator is disabled on the page
  • v5.4.1 2023-03-25

    Fixed exclusions for subscription filter

  • v5.4.0 2023-03-19

    Added auto application of settings updated in another tab.

  • v5.3.5 2023-01-17

    Made the observer to search inside dynamically added nodes for items

  • v5.3.4 2022-12-08

    Rating filter fix

  • v5.3.3 2022-12-04
  • v5.3.2 2022-11-24
  • v5.3.1 2022-11-11
  • v5.3.1 2022-11-11

    Bugfix

  • v5.3.0 2022-11-11
  • v5.3.0 2022-11-11

    More automations and shortcut to get config

  • v5.2.0 2022-11-10
  • v5.2.0 2022-11-10
  • v5.1.0 2022-11-10

    More automation

  • v5.0.0 2022-11-09

    More automation

  • v4.0.0 2022-11-08

    Better config and paginator handling

  • v2.10.3 2022-11-08
  • v2.10.3 2022-11-08
  • v2.10.2 2022-11-08
  • v2.10.1 2022-11-08
  • v2.10.1 2022-11-08
  • v2.10.0 2022-11-08
  • v3.2.1 2022-11-08
  • v3.2.0 2021-06-19
  • v3.1.0 2021-06-09

    Many optimizations and fixes

  • v3.0.0 2021-06-04
  • v2.9.0 2021-04-04
  • v2.8.0 2021-02-10 Added validation check auto resolution based on config type
  • v2.7.6 2021-01-27 Config Sync
  • v2.7.5 2021-01-13
  • v2.7.4 2021-01-13
  • v2.7.3 2021-01-13
  • v2.7.2 2021-01-09
  • v2.7.1 2021-01-09
  • v2.7.0 2021-01-09
  • v2.6.0 2021-01-09 Some more filter presets
  • v2.5.0 2021-01-05 Internal filters are now not added to all scripts by default
  • v2.4.0 2020-12-25
  • v2.4.0 2020-12-25
  • v2.3.0 2020-12-20
  • v2.2.1 2020-12-18 Bugfixes
  • v2.2.0 2020-12-15
  • v2.1.3 2020-12-11 Bugfixes
  • v2.1.2 2020-12-09 Bugfixes
  • v2.1.1 2020-12-09 Bugfixes
  • v2.1.0 2020-12-07 Separated paginator
  • v2.0.3 2020-12-06
  • v2.0.2 2020-12-06 Bugfixes
  • v2.0.1 2020-12-06 Bugfixes
  • v2.0.0 2020-12-06 Refactor to include automated configuration management
  • v1.0.1 2020-11-17 Various fixes
  • v1.0.0 2020-11-14
  • v1.0.0 2020-11-14